There is now a description on my web site that describes the detailed
modifications to move the KPA100 module from the K2 to a separate EC2
enclosure. This allows you to run the KPA100 module remotely such as
installing it in the trunk of a car for mobile operation. This type of
installation will even be more useful when the high power antenna tuner
becomes available later this year.
I do have one warning for anyone performing this type of modification to the
KPA100. During testing of the KPA100 module, I found that extremely strong
spurious signals can be generated on 40 meters when several feet or more of
coaxial cable is connected to the KPA100 module RF input. These spurious
outputs are not a problem when the KPA100 module is mounted inside the K2
enclosure as designed by Elecraft. These spurious outputs may have
intensity of up to 1 watt of power and are not inside any amateur band. The
instructions include a modification to the KPA100 circuit board to eliminate
this problem.
